Why These Are the Top Roofing Contractors in Jemez Springs

The roofing market in and around Jemez Springs is characterized by a limited number of hyper-local providers, with the majority of services being supplied by established contractors from the Albuquerque/Rio Rancho metropolitan area. The competition is moderate; while there aren't dozens of companies vying for business, the ones that do serve the area are typically well-established and reputable. Quality is generally high, as contractors must be equipped to handle the specific challenges of the region, including high winds, hail, snow load, and the potential for wildfire-related damage. Typical pricing is at a premium compared to larger cities due to the travel distance and the rural nature of the service calls. Homeowners and businesses should expect to pay a service area fee, but this is standard for reliable professional service in a remote location.

Frequently Asked Questions About Roofing in Jemez Springs

Get answers to common questions about roofing services in Jemez Springs, New Mexico.

1What are the most important factors to consider when choosing a roofing material for my home in Jemez Springs?

In Jemez Springs, the key factors are durability against high desert sun (UV degradation), thermal performance for both hot summers and cold winters, and resistance to occasional heavy snow loads. Excellent choices for our climate include metal roofing for its longevity and snow-shedding ability, and high-quality asphalt shingles rated for high UV resistance. It's also wise to consider materials with good fire resistance due to the regional wildfire risk.

2How does the local climate and elevation in Jemez Springs affect the timing and scheduling of a roof replacement?

The high elevation (over 6,000 feet) and distinct seasons create a narrow optimal window for roofing work. The best time is typically late spring through early fall (May to October), avoiding the monsoon rains of July/August and the winter snow. Scheduling early is critical, as reputable local roofers have limited capacity during this short season, and winter conditions can make work unsafe or impossible.

3Are there specific local permits or regulations in Sandoval County/Jemez Springs I need to be aware of for a roofing project?

Yes, most roofing projects in Sandoval County require a building permit. If your home is within the Village of Jemez Springs boundaries or a designated historic area, there may be additional architectural review or aesthetic guidelines. A reputable local roofer will handle this process, but you should always verify they are pulling the proper permits to ensure code compliance, especially for wind and snow load requirements.

4What is the typical price range for a full roof replacement in Jemez Springs, and what causes variations?

For a standard single-family home, a full replacement typically ranges from $8,500 to $20,000+. Key cost factors include the roof's size and pitch, the material chosen (metal being premium), the complexity of the roof design (valleys, dormers), and the cost of tear-off and disposal. Prices can be higher than in flatter urban areas due to our mountainous terrain, travel distance for crews, and the premium for materials suited to our harsh climate.

5With the threat of wildfires in the area, are there roofing options that can improve my home's fire resistance?

Absolutely. Choosing a Class A fire-rated roofing material is highly recommended. The best options for our area include metal roofing, concrete/clay tiles, and certain asphalt shingles specifically designed and tested for fire resistance. It's also crucial to maintain a defensible space by keeping the roof and gutters clear of pine needles and other flammable debris that are common in Jemez Springs.
